最简单的区块链钱包应用:轻松管理你的数字资

引言

在数字经济蓬勃发展的今天,区块链技术已逐渐成为一种新兴的趋势,而区块链钱包作为用户与区块链网络交互的重要工具,其重要性不言而喻。区块链钱包的核心功能在于储存、发送和接收加密货币,然而,复杂的用户界面和技术细节常常让初学者感到困惑。因此,开发出一种简单易用的区块链钱包应用,显得尤为重要。在本文中,我们将深入探讨最简单的区块链钱包应用,包括其定义、功能和实现方式等,并围绕这一主题,解答四个相关的问题,以便让用户更好地理解和使用区块链钱包。

什么是区块链钱包应用?

区块链钱包应用是用于存储、发送和接收加密货币的软件工具。与传统的银行账户不同,区块链钱包不储存实际的货币,而是存储用户的私钥和公钥。私钥是用户管理其数字资产的凭证,而公钥则是一种可以与他人共享的地址,用于接收加密货币。

区块链钱包可以分为热钱包和冷钱包两种类型。热钱包是指与互联网连接的电子钱包,方便用户随时存取资金;而冷钱包则是离线存储的设备或纸质钱包,适合长时间存储加密货币。简单的区块链钱包应用通常是热钱包,因其操作便捷而受到用户的青睐。

区块链钱包的基本功能

一个优秀的区块链钱包应用应具备以下基本功能:

  • 创建和管理钱包:用户可以通过简单的步骤创建新钱包,并管理多个钱包地址。
  • 接收资金:用户可以轻松生成公钥(钱包地址),以便其他用户向其发送加密货币。
  • 发送资金:用户可以通过输入接收者的公钥及转账金额,快速完成交易。
  • 查看交易历史:用户可以随时查看自己的交易记录,了解账户的变动情况。
  • 安全性设置:提供多种安全措施,如密码保护、指纹识别、双重身份验证等,确保用户资产的安全。

如何开发一个简单的区块链钱包应用?

开发区块链钱包应用并不是一件简单的事情,但借助现有的开发工具和框架,开发者可以相对容易地构建一个简单的区块链钱包应用。以下是一些基本步骤:

  • 选择技术栈:根据需求选择适合的编程语言和框架。例如,使用JavaScript和Node.js来构建后端、React或Vue.js用于前端界面。
  • 整合区块链API:通过第三方区块链API服务(如Blockchain.info或Coinbase)获取区块链数据并实现钱包的基本功能。
  • 用户界面设计:设计简洁友好的用户界面,确保用户操作的简易性和直观性。
  • 安全措施:在设计时充分考虑安全性,保护用户的私钥和账户信息,防止被恶意攻击。
  • 测试和:在应用发布前,进行充分的测试,确保其在不同设备上的兼容性和稳定性。

相关问题探讨

区块链钱包的安全性如何保障?

区块链钱包的安全性是用户最为关注的问题之一。与传统银行相比,数字资产的管理更多地依赖于用户自身的安全措施。为了保护钱包的安全,用户应采取多种手段:

  • 选择可信赖的钱包应用:用户应选择知名度高、评价好的钱包应用。查看应用的开发者背景和用户评价,了解其安全性表现。
  • 启用双重身份验证:很多区块链钱包应用提供双重身份验证选项。用户在登录时需要输入密码和通过短信或邮件发送的验证码,这能大大提高安全性。
  • 定期备份私钥:用户应定期备份自己的私钥,并将其保存在安全的地方。备份可以是纸质的、USB硬盘的或云存储的,但都需避免与网络直接连接。
  • 使用冷钱包存储大额资产:对于长期存储的大额数字资产,建议使用冷钱包(如硬件钱包),以减少网络攻击的风险。
  • 定期更新应用:用户应定期更新其应用,及时解决已知的安全漏洞。开发者也会通过更新增强应用的安全性。

通过以上措施,用户可以在很大程度上保障其区块链钱包的安全性,减少资产被盗的风险。

区块链钱包如何简化用户体验?

对于初学者而言,复杂的用户体验往往是使用区块链钱包的最大障碍。因此,简化用户体验是开发优秀区块链钱包应用的关键。在用户体验设计中,以下几个方面尤为重要:

  • 简洁的界面设计:钱包应用应避免过于复杂的功能及华丽的界面,保持简洁易懂的设计,让用户在最短时间内上手使用。
  • 清晰的操作引导:提供详细的操作引导和帮助文档,帮助用户理解如何创建钱包、发送接收资金、查看交易等基本功能。
  • 智能化的功能设置:根据用户的使用频率和习惯,为用户推荐常用功能,帮助其快速找到需要的选项。
  • 反馈机制:提供便捷的反馈渠道,让用户在遇到问题时可以快速分享到有帮助的客服或社区,增强其使用信心。
  • 多语言支持:考虑到全球化的背景,区块链钱包应用应提供多语言支持,满足不同用户的需求。

通过建立友好的用户体验,区块链钱包应用能吸引更多用户,促进加密货币的使用和交流。

如何选择合适的区块链钱包?

面对市场上众多类型的区块链钱包,用户必须根据自己的需求做出合适的选择。在进行选择时,用户应考虑以下几个关键要素:

  • 安全性:用户应优先考虑钱包的安全性,选择那些具有双重身份验证、良好口碑和安全性评估的钱包应用。
  • 易用性:初学者尤其需要选择易于操作的钱包,注意应用的界面设计、操作简洁性和用户评价等。
  • 支持的加密货币:不同的钱包支持不同种类的加密货币,用户需确保选定的钱包支持其常用的数字资产。
  • 客户服务:优秀的钱包应用通常会提供良好的客户服务,确保用户在遇到问题时能获得及时的帮助。
  • 费用结构:用户要关注钱包的费用结构,尤其是转账手续费,以避免不必要的支出。

通过综合考虑以上因素,用户可以选择到适合自己的区块链钱包及其应用,确保安全与便利共存。

区块链钱包的未来发展方向

随着区块链技术的不断发展,区块链钱包的功能和应用场景也在不断扩大。未来,区块链钱包将朝着以下几个方向发展:

  • 增强的安全性措施:随着网络攻击的增加,区块链钱包将引入更多先进的安全措施,如生物识别技术、全新的加密算法等,确保用户资产更加安全。
  • 跨平台兼容性:未来的钱包应用将更加注重跨平台能够性,以支持在手机、平板、电脑等不同设备上的无缝使用。
  • 与其他金融服务的集成:区块链钱包将与传统金融服务深化整合,让用户可以轻松地将数字资产与传统货币相互兑换,提高资金流动性。
  • 智能合约的应用:随着去中心化应用(DApp)和智能合约的兴起,未来的钱包可能会支持更多的功能,甚至作为智能合约的执行平台,为用户提供更广泛的服务。

总之,区块链钱包的功能将不断拓展,而用户在选择和使用钱包时,也应该保持持续关注,以适应快速变化的行业环境。

结论

随着区块链技术的发展,区块链钱包作为用户与数字资产的桥梁,具有越来越重要的地位。本文探讨了什么是区块链钱包、如何选择和开发钱包应用、钱包的安全性等方面的问题。通过确保用户体验的简化与安全性,未来的区块链钱包将会吸引更多用户加入数字资产的世界。选择一款合适的钱包,用户不仅可以轻松管理他们的数字资产,还能积极参与到这场数字货币的革命之中。